The size of Bungador is approximately 36.1 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.9% of total area. The population of Bungador in 2016 was 62 people. By 2021 the population was 65 showing a population growth of 4.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bungador is 50-59 years. Households in Bungador are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bungador work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 66.70% of the homes in Bungador were owner-occupied compared with 50.00% in 2016.
